No traffic touring cycling routes around Garrevaques traverse a landscape characterized by a privileged natural environment, featuring numerous streams, rivers, and lakes. The region offers varied terrain, from gentle paths along historical waterways like the Rigole de la Montagne to more challenging routes through the nearby Montagne Noire. This area, part of the broader Haut-Languedoc Regional Natural Park, encompasses deep forests, wild heathlands, and clear lakes, providing diverse backdrops for cycling.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no traffic touring cycling routes are available around Garrevaques?

There are over 80 dedicated no-traffic touring cycling routes around Garrevaques, offering a wide range of distances and difficulties. You'll find everything from easy, flat paths to more challenging rides with significant elevation.

What kind of terrain can I expect on these no-traffic routes?

The routes around Garrevaques offer varied terrain. You can enjoy gentle, flat paths along historical waterways like the Rigole de la Plaine, which is perfect for leisurely rides. For those seeking more challenge, routes venturing into the nearby Montagne Noire will feature more significant climbs and descents, providing rewarding views of the Haut-Languedoc Regional Natural Park.

Are there any family-friendly no-traffic cycling routes?

Yes, several routes are ideal for families. The paths along the Rigole de la Montagne and Rigole de la Plaine are particularly noted for being flat and pleasant, offering a safe and enjoyable experience away from traffic. These historical waterways provide a unique and scenic backdrop for family outings.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ions I can visit along the routes?

Many routes pass by or lead to interesting attractions. You can cycle to the charming bastide town of Revel, explore the UNESCO World Heritage site of Lac de Saint-Ferréol, or follow the historical La Rigole de la Plaine. Other points of interest include the ancient village of Sorèze and the historic Château de Garrevaques.

What is the best time of year to go touring cycling in Garrevaques?

The best time for touring cycling in the Tarn department, including Garrevaques, is generally during spring (April to June) and autumn (September to October). During these months, the weather is typically mild and pleasant, with less heat than summer and fewer crowds, making for ideal cycling conditions. Summer can be hot, especially in July and August.

Are there any circular no-traffic routes available?

Yes, there are several circular routes designed for touring cyclists. For example, the "Revel Market Hall – Revel loop from Revel" offers a moderate 27 km ride, allowing you to start and finish in the same location without retracing your steps.

Can I bring my dog on these cycling routes?

Many natural paths and voies vertes in France, including those around Garrevaques, are generally dog-friendly, especially if your dog is on a leash. However, specific regulations can vary, particularly within protected areas like the Haut-Languedoc Regional Natural Park. Always ensure your dog is well-behaved and that you clean up after them. It's advisable to check local signage for any specific restrictions.

Where can I find parking for these no-traffic cycling routes?

Parking is typically available in the towns and villages that serve as starting points for many routes, such as Revel or Sorèze. For routes along the Rigole de la Plaine or near Lac de Saint-Ferréol, designated parking areas are often provided for visitors accessing these popular sites.

What is the difficulty level of the no-traffic touring routes?

The routes around Garrevaques cater to all levels. You'll find 20 easy routes, 42 moderate routes, and 23 difficult routes. Easy routes often follow flat waterways, while difficult routes, such as the "Medieval village of Sorèze – Arfons loop from Revel", involve significant elevation changes, perfect for experienced cyclists seeking a challenge.

What do other touring cyclists enjoy most about cycling in Garrevaques?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.2 stars from nearly 90 reviews. Reviewers often praise the tranquil, traffic-free environment, the picturesque landscapes, and the opportunity to explore historical sites and charming villages at a leisurely pace.

Are there any long-distance no-traffic routes suitable for multi-day touring?

While many routes are day trips, the region connects to longer networks. The Rigole de la Plaine, for instance, is part of the larger Canal du Midi system, offering extensive flat paths. For a challenging multi-day experience, the "Circuit of the Black Mountain" provides a more demanding route through varied landscapes, though specific no-traffic sections may vary.
